Hepatitic inherited metabolic disorders

This review covers common inherited metabolic disorders presenting with liver issues. Early diagnosis through clinical, lab, and genetic analysis is crucial for managing alpha1-antitrypsin disorder, Wilson disease, cystic fibrosis, and PFIC syndromes.
Area of Science:
- Hepatology
- Medical Genetics
- Pediatric Gastroenterology
Background:
- Primary metabolic disorders encompass diverse conditions, some affecting the liver with varied histopathology.
- Accurate diagnosis necessitates integrating clinical, laboratory, and genetic findings.
Purpose of the Study:
- To review three common inherited metabolic disorders presenting with a hepatitic pattern.
- To highlight diagnostic considerations for alpha1-antitrypsin disorder, Wilson disease, cystic fibrosis, and progressive familial intrahepatic cholestasis (PFIC) syndromes.
Main Methods:
- Review of literature on inherited metabolic disorders with hepatic manifestations.
- Discussion of clinical presentations, histopathology, and diagnostic approaches.
Main Results:
- Alpha1-antitrypsin disorder shows variable presentation from neonatal hepatitis to chronic progressive disease.
- Wilson disease typically presents as chronic hepatitis in older children and adults.
- Cystic fibrosis can manifest with obstructive biliary syndrome.
- PFIC syndromes lead to progressive cholestatic liver disease and cirrhosis, with specific gamma-glutamyl transpeptidase (GGT) patterns differentiating subtypes.
Conclusions:
- These inherited metabolic disorders are important considerations in the differential diagnosis of liver disease across age groups.
- Genetic analysis is essential for definitive diagnosis, particularly for rare PFIC syndromes.
